Disadvantage or not, it acquited itself quite well. The way FWOTY works is that any 4x4 that is significantly new or revised is eligible and therefore invited to participate. We have 5 areas of scoring, and in 4 of those 5, the vehicles are only compared to vehicles in their class. Only in emperical are they compared to everything else in the test. This makes the test more fair in terms of vehicles in different price ranges, as well as size.
